The Elico Soldering Blowtorch PALNIK LUTOWNICZY PIEZO is a handheld gas flame tool designed for portable soldering and light heating tasks. It features a 190 g fuel capacity and a built-in piezo ignition for quick, one-handed lighting. The product is supplied with four interchangeable nozzles that provide a range of flame shapes and sizes to suit precision soldering, heating shrink tubing, light plumbing work, and small metal repairs.
The blowtorch offers a compact, handheld design that makes it easy to carry and operate in confined spaces. Piezo ignition eliminates the need for external lighters or matches, while the 190 g fuel capacity provides extended runtime for multiple small jobs. Supplied interchangeable nozzles increase versatility by enabling different flame widths and intensities for precision tasks or broader heating needs. The unit is intended for quick heat application and localised soldering where a portable gas flame is required.
Before use, ensure the torch is filled with the recommended fuel and that connections are secure. Select and attach the nozzle that matches the required flame shape, then open the fuel valve according to the manufacturer’s markings. Ignite the torch using the piezo starter and adjust the flame size by controlling the fuel valve. Maintain a steady distance from the workpiece to apply heat evenly, moving the flame as needed for solder flow or shrinkage. After finishing, close the fuel valve to extinguish the flame and allow the torch to cool before storing.
Use the tool in a well-ventilated area, keep flammable materials clear of the work zone, and wear appropriate eye and hand protection. For precision soldering, use a smaller nozzle and lower flame setting; for faster heating or plumbing tasks, select a larger nozzle and increase the flame. Do not use the torch on pressurized containers or sealed assemblies, and follow local safety regulations for gas handling and storage.
